What to Look for in a Qualified Fitness Professional

When you’re picking a gym, the quality of the trainers is absolutely crucial. You want to find someone who’s got the right credentials, like certifications from respected organizations such as the American College of Sports Medicine (ACSM) or the National Strength and Conditioning Association (NSCA), and even certifications accredited by the Philippine Sports Commission (PSC). These certifications mean that the trainer has gone through a serious amount of training in areas like exercise science, anatomy, and different workout techniques.

A great trainer will start with a thorough assessment to understand your medical history, fitness level, and what you’re hoping to achieve. This helps them create a fitness plan that’s challenging but also safe and appropriate for you.

Pay attention to how the trainer interacts with their clients. Are they paying attention, being patient, and offering encouragement? Do they seem genuinely invested in helping people reach their goals?

Finally, it’s a bonus if the trainer understands the Filipino lifestyle and culture. They’ll be more aware of the challenges you might face, like a demanding job or a busy social schedule, and can help you find ways to fit fitness into your life.

What Makes a Great Local Gym?

Besides the trainers, the actual gym environment is super important too. A good gym should have a wide range of equipment, including cardio machines like treadmills and ellipticals. There should also be plenty of weights, from light dumbbells to heavier barbells, to suit all fitness levels.

Having a spacious area for stretching, bodyweight exercises, and group classes is also key. And let’s not forget cleanliness! A clean and well-maintained gym is a must, especially in a busy city.

Make sure the air conditioning is working well, especially during those hot months, and that the shower and locker rooms are kept clean. Cleanliness isn’t just about looks; it’s about your health and safety.

Lastly, take a look at the overall atmosphere of the gym. Does it feel welcoming, well-lit, and supportive? Do the members seem happy and motivated? The vibe of the gym can really impact your motivation and how much you enjoy working out.

Examples of Gyms in the Philippines

Within Metro Manila, big chains like Anytime Fitness and Gold’s Gym are well known for their state-of-the-art gear and large class options. A lot of these gyms even offer 24-hour access, which is super convenient if you have a busy schedule.

For those on a budget, there are local studios like Elorde Boxing Gym that specializes in boxing workouts, which can be a really fun and culturally relevant way to get in shape.

Over in in Cebu, gyms such as Fitness First and Holiday Gym are rocking top-notch amenities and super-knowing staff. You’ll find smaller, community-focused gyms popping up in areas that are outside of the major cities, which can give you a more personalized feel.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a gym membership typically cost in the Philippines?

Gym membership prices in the Philippines can vary quite a bit depending on where you are, what amenities are offered, and the gym’s brand. Budget-friendly gyms might charge around PHP 1,000 per month, while more upscale gyms could cost more than PHP 5,000 per month.

What qualifications should a fitness trainer in the Philippines have?

A good fitness trainer should have certifications from reputable organizations like ACSM or NSCA, or certifications recognized by the Philippine Sports Commission (PSC). They should also have practical experience in providing fitness instruction.

Are there gyms that cater to specific exercise styles, such as yoga or CrossFit?

Absolutely! Many gyms in the Philippines specialize in specific exercise methods. You can find yoga studios, boxing-focused gyms, and dedicated CrossFit facilities. It’s best to research what’s available in your area.

How can I find a gym that best suits my needs in the Philippines?

When you’re searching for a gym, think about things like the types of equipment they have, how far you’ll have to travel, the membership costs, the community vibe, and your specific health goals. It’s always a good idea to take a trial session or ask for a tour before signing up for a membership.

Is it common for gyms in the Philippines to offer nutrition advice?

More gyms are starting to offer basic nutrition advice as they recognize the importance of overall wellness. However, if you have specific dietary requirements, it’s best to consult a registered dietitian or nutritionist.
